In an industrial landscape increasingly defined by sustainability and energy efficiency, accurately simulating non-Newtonian fluid behavior has become a critical advantage. From biomedical precision to the massive scales of oil, gas, and food manufacturing, fluids that defy traditional Newtonian laws demand specialized approaches. This book focuses on mathematical modeling, computational techniques, and real-world industrial applications of non-Newtonian fluids, with in-depth coverage of flow behavior, heat transfer, and mechanical properties. Emphasis is placed on practical modeling and simulation, particularly in polymer processing, food production, and oil drilling. Bridging foundational rheological theory with advanced computational practice, the volume explores shear-thinning, shear-thickening, and viscoelastic behaviors, offering a comprehensive roadmap for navigating complex non-Newtonian dynamics in industrial settings
